This 1971 Chevrolet Camaro custom coupe has received an extensive
two-year rotisserie restoration and is finished in classic GM
Summit White. It's powered by a Whipple-supercharged, Vengeance
Racing-built, LT1 direct-injected V8 engine. The engine features a
Whipple 2.9-liter inter-cooled supercharger, Vengeance Racing's CNC
ported cylinder heads and a Stage 3 camshaft. Power is sent through
a Circle D Pro Series torque converter. Stainless headers and a
custom 3-inch exhaust with electric cutouts complete the package.
The Camaro features a Quick Performance-fabricated 9-inch rear end
with RideTech 4-link suspension and front control arms, with their
HQ shockwaves at each corner. An Airlift Performance Bluetooth
management system controls the height and pressures. The subframe
was powder-coated, and Detroit Speed mini-tubs were installed to
accommodate the wide 20-inch rear staggered-wheel package. The
front utilizes 19x8.5-inch wheels, both fitted with 6-piston
Wilwood brakes and Yokohama Advan Apex tires. Kindig-It Designs
flush-mount door handles, Ringbrothers billet hood hinges, a cowl
hood and LED lighting finish the exterior. The car has a completely
new interior featuring all-leather Procar seats, an Ididit steering
column, TMI center console, Dakota Digital gauges, a Vintage Air
system, JL Audio system with Retrosound head unit, a custom
horseshoe shifter and Billet Specialties steering wheel.
